OverviewIT is stated in the preface that the purpose of this book is to present those portions of differential equations which are most used by engineers. It was written with reference to the needs of two classes of students; those who take the subject as a preparation for the study of mechanics, and students in electrical engineering who are already well grounded in the physical ideas involved in the electrical problems. The former take the first three chapters, omitting the electrical problems: the latter complete the book. The examples were prepared with the double purpose of illustrating the text, and of affording a review of some of the more important operations of the calculus. Answers are given and stress is laid on the importance of verifying results.
